Industry-Specific Drivers Electronics & Display Industry: The surge in foldable smartphones, OLED displays, and flexible electronics necessitates advanced inks with high durability, flexibility, and temperature resistance—traits inherent to silicone-based formulations. Automotive Sector: Increasing adoption of silicone-based inks in interior and exterior coatings, as well as in electronic components, driven by demand for high-performance, weather-resistant, and environmentally friendly materials. Packaging & Printing: Premium packaging solutions requiring high-end inks with excellent adhesion, chemical resistance, and longevity bolster demand. Technological Advancements & Emerging Opportunities Innovations such as UV-curable silicone inks, nano-enhanced formulations, and system integration for digital printing are transforming the landscape. The advent of smart inks embedded with sensors and conductive properties opens new avenues in IoT-enabled devices and wearable tech. Market Ecosystem & Operational Framework Product Categories UV-Curable Silicone Inks: Widely used in high-resolution printing, electronics, and display manufacturing. Solvent-Based Silicone Inks: Preferred for outdoor applications, automotive coatings, and industrial printing. Water-Based Silicone Inks: Gaining traction due to environmental regulations and sustainability trends. Cost Structures, Pricing Strategies, and Risk Factors Cost Structures & Operating Margins Raw materials constitute approximately 40–50% of production costs, with silicone monomers and nano-additives being premium-priced inputs. Manufacturing involves high capital expenditure (CAPEX) for specialized equipment, with operating margins typically ranging between 15–25%, depending on product complexity and scale. Pricing Strategies Premium pricing is prevalent for high-performance, specialty inks. Volume discounts and long-term supply agreements are common among large OEM clients. Custom formulations command higher margins, especially when integrated with system solutions. Key Risks & Challenges Regulatory & Environmental Challenges: Stringent regulations on volatile organic compounds (VOCs) and hazardous chemicals necessitate compliance and innovation in eco-friendly formulations. Cybersecurity & IP Risks: Increasing digitalization exposes firms to data breaches and intellectual property theft. Market Volatility: Fluctuations in raw material prices and geopolitical tensions can disrupt supply chains. Adoption Trends & End-User Insights Electronics & Display Silicone-based inks are increasingly used in flexible, foldable displays, with real-world applications in smartphones, tablets, and wearable devices. The demand for high-resolution, durable, and environmentally stable inks is rising, driven by consumer electronics innovation cycles. Automotive Automotive interior and exterior coatings utilizing silicone inks offer superior weather resistance and longevity. The shift toward electric vehicles (EVs) and smart automotive components further propels demand for specialized inks. Packaging & Printing Premium packaging, especially in luxury goods and pharmaceuticals, favors silicone-based inks for their chemical resistance and aesthetic qualities. Digital printing adoption is increasing, with silicone inks enabling high-speed, high-quality outputs.
